take the panel off that covers the top of the brake pedal, they are held on by 2 screws located by the center consul, then there are 2 clips that hold the panel on, you will find a heater section that comes off when you remove the holding plug and then pull out of the slot, once you have done this then you will be aboe to see the brake switch, this is held on a metal braket and all you have to do is twist the switch, i would be careful as normally they are covered in grease, then its as simple as uncliping from the wires, this is a hard place to get to so move the drivers seat back as far as it will go and then lay on your back on the door sil, good luck its is simple

To change the brake switch in a 2004 Ford Excursion, first disconnect the battery to ensure safety. Locate the brake switch, which is typically mounted above the brake pedal. Remove the electrical connector and the mounting screws, then take out the old switch. Install the new switch by reversing the process, securing it in place, and reconnecting the battery.

To change the brake light switch on a Skoda Fabia, first, disconnect the vehicle's battery to ensure safety. Locate the brake light switch, which is typically situated above the brake pedal. Remove the electrical connector from the switch and unbolt or unscrew the switch from its mounting. Install the new switch by reversing the process, ensuring it is securely fastened, and reconnect the battery to test the lights.
